Bill Summary

Amends the Criminal Code of 2012. Provides that the sentence for aggravated criminal sexual assault, which does not otherwise provide for an enhanced penalty, is a Class X felony for which 5 years shall be added to the term of imprisonment imposed by the court. Provides that the sentence for predatory criminal sexual assault of a child, which does not otherwise provide for an enhanced penalty, is a Class X felony with a minimum term of imprisonment of 11 (rather than 6) years.

AI Summary

This bill amends the Criminal Code of 2012 to increase penalties for certain sexual assault offenses. Specifically, for aggravated criminal sexual assault, the bill adds a mandatory 5-year enhancement to the imprisonment term for offenses that do not already have a specific penalty enhancement. For predatory criminal sexual assault of a child, the minimum term of imprisonment is increased from 6 to 11 years. The bill applies to cases involving various aggravating circumstances, such as the use of weapons, causing bodily harm, threatening the victim's life, committing the assault during another felony, or targeting victims who are elderly or have disabilities. The legislation maintains different sentencing guidelines for offenders under 18 years old, referencing the Unified Code of Corrections for juvenile sentencing. These changes aim to strengthen legal protections for victims and impose more severe consequences for perpetrators of sexual assault, particularly those involving children or vulnerable individuals.
